    Lookout Mountain

    Lookout Mountain boasts scenic views, hiking trails, and The Town Common. This small community has a highly rated elementary school. Residents enjoy a quiet atmosphere while downtown Chattanooga is just a 7-mile commute away.

    Collegedale

    Collegedale in Ooltewah, home to Little Debbie snacks and Southern Adventist University, features The Commons for events. Outdoor spots include White Oak Mountain Trails and Little Debbie Park. Crime risk is below average.
